"In aankhon say jo kuch dekhtey ho vah Satyug may kuch bhi nahi rahega, jungle ho jayega. Abu thodey hee Satyug may hoga, darkaar hee nahee. Yah mandir aadi sab baad may Bhaktimarg may banengey. Kitnee oonchi pahadi par mandir banaatey hain. Fir thandi may band kar neechey utar aatey hain. Tum toh pahadi par baithey ho. Ant may sab pahadi par hee saakshaatkaar hongey. Baba batlaatey hain - mujhey bhi jab saakshaatkaar hua tha toh mai pahadi par tha. Ab bhi pahadi par aakar anaayaas hee baithey hain. Yahaan baithey-baithey tum sab kuch sunengey aur dekhengey. Yahaan baithey saakshaatkaar ho sakta hai ki kaisey aag lagtee hai. Kya-kya hota hai. Radio say, akhbaaron say sab kuch tum sunengey. TV may bhi tum dekh saktey ho. Aagey chalkar aisi-aisi cheezein niklengi jo ghar baithey sab dikhaai padega."

"Whatever you see through these eyes, would not exist in the Golden Age. It would become a jungle. Abu will not be there in the Golden Age. There would not be any need at all. All these temples etc. would be constructed later on in the path of worship. They build temples on such high mountains. Then they close the temple during the winters and come down. You are sitting on a mountain. In the end all the divine visions would be caused on the mountains only. Baba says - Even when I had divine vision, I was on a mountain. Even now we have come and are coincidentally sitting on a mountain. While sitting here, you would hear and see everything. You can have divine visions while sitting here that how the fire gets ignited. What all would happen. You would listen about everything through Radio, through newspapers. You can see on the TV also. In future, such things would emerge, through which everything would be visible while sitting at home." (Revised Sakar Murli dated 14.12.06, pg.3 published by the BKs in Hindi, narrated by Father Shiv through Brahma Baba; translated by a PBK)

The classical Yagya history that the BKs generally present to the world says that Brahma Baba had divine visions in his room and Shiva entered into him and uttered Sanskrit Shloka (for which there is no proof in the Murlis). But the above Murli point, which I too have read for the first time in my Brahmin life says that Brahma Baba had divine visions on a mountain. Oh, I missed an important detail out John. Through the 1940s, they used to call themselves;

Prajapati Brahma Kumaris. "Divine Daughters of DIVINE Father PRAJAPATI BRAHMA, The Gita Gyan Inventor, The Imparter of Impersihable Wisdom and The Bestower of Divine Insight."

alladin wrote:Mandali on the basis of his intoxication without any mention of God? Could anybody verify this with some SS who was around at that time or some reliable source?
Yes, Prajapati Brama was called the Divine Father and the BKs were at that time called the "Divine Ones". The "Divine Father and His Divine Ones". There is no mention of Shiva.

These are from Om Radhe who the BWSU pitch as some saintly giant of a woman and number 2 souls in the world. She, and they, were off her head. Here she is talking about World War II (1939 to 1945) being the End of the World/Destruction and here is an example of a letter they were sending out to "military marshalls and commanders" instructing them on scortch earth tactics. So, you can note that down as another embarrassing re-write.
In 1942 Om Radhe wrote:"In such a manner," explains Divine Father PRAJAPATI BRAHMA to his Divine Ones, "I, that selfsame Viceless Deity Kalgidhar SREE Krishna of Vaikunth or BRAHM-PURI, have now incarnated with a different name in the form of an ordinary human being performing various Divine Deeds such as manifesting Jyoti Tattwa (Infinite Divine Light), Adi Sanatan Divine Chaturbhuj Form, BRAHM-PURI or Vaikunth, Kalgidhar Krishna Bal-Lila (Divine Child-Play), Ras-Lila (Divine Dance) and the scenes of ensuing annihilation through Divine Insight and also revealing all the deep secrets of all the Shastras to you. But the Science-Proud European Yadvas, the present rulers of Bharat, and even the Bharatvasi Kaurvas (Congress), Kansas, Jarasandis, etc., amongst whom I have been born, fail to recognise ME. They consider ME as a person of no consequence and adore ME as the abductor of Virgins
The typesetting, although not font, is as per the original.
